pyOpenSci / pyos-sphinx-theme

A standard sphinx theme that is customized to use the pyos theme and brand elements
https://www.pyopensci.org/pyos-sphinx-theme
BSD 3-Clause "New" or "Revised" License
2 stars 6 forks source link

Work on: pyos sphinx-theme: Build out pyos-sphinx-theme repo #2

Open lwasser opened 6 months ago

lwasser commented 6 months ago

At pyOpenSci we have 3 sphinx books that we use to create online content for peer review, our

each book has customizations that we need to move to different other books. It would be much easier if we could have a pyos sphinx theme to use and call for each that builds on top of the pydata-sphinx-theme we are already using and adds custom styles, etc for pyOpenSci!

I started this repo to create that theme however i really don't know a lot about creating themes. what is here may not work.

If someone could help as a starting place with getting the theme working and perhaps creating a list of things that people could do to help build it out at sprints that would be wonderful!!

vsalvino commented 4 months ago

@lwasser I just learned about pyOpenSci at PyCon. Excellent work :) I happen to know a bit about sphinx themes and would love to help! BUT I'm not familiar with pyOpenSci as a whole. Here's what I'm thinking...

I can start out with:

lwasser commented 4 months ago

hey @vsalvino 👋🏻 !! Wow - thank you so so much. that would be incredible! i can definitely help provide that information:

and then any custom conf.py settings in the package guide repo that we can port to a theme rather than having to set them in each book would be wonderful. i don't know enough about sphinx themes to know what exactly we can and can't customize but the goal is to extend the pydata_sphinx_theme as you mention.

your help on this would be wonderful if you still have bandwidth. i'm heading back home and won't be around for the sprints tomorrow but i can support online as needed (in between when i'm traveling!).

does this help? 🙌🏻

vsalvino commented 4 months ago

This is super helpful, thanks! I left on Sunday but was going to work on this on free time throughout the week. I think I have everything I need.

P.S. My specialties are Django, Wagtail, Sphinx, Sass/CSS, some JavaScript, and all things web-hosting/server related. Feel free to tag me if you ever need a helping hand on any of those topics in the future!

lwasser commented 4 months ago

@vsalvino thank you so much! we really appreciate the help. i was out at a meeting so i'm just getting back / catching up on things. i will attach your handle to this issue!! please reach out if you have questions!!

lwasser commented 4 months ago

@all-contributors please add @vsalvino for review

allcontributors[bot] commented 4 months ago

@lwasser

I've put up a pull request to add @vsalvino! :tada:

vsalvino commented 4 months ago

Thanks :) I haven't contributed anything yet... but am working on it slowly but surely!

lwasser commented 4 months ago

No worries. Also please don't feel pressured by my messages! I'm just catching up on issues today